			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Quizno&#8217;s is interesting because, depending on the location, the experience can vary greatly. In my experiences, it seems that most Quizno&#8217;s are franchise owned, and the individual owners have widely different ideas about how to run a business, and how to treat their customers. Some give great service, give a hearty helping of toppings, and honor all coupons. Some locations don&#8217;t honor Internet coupons, some don&#8217;t honor particular flier coupons, and some are very stingy on toppings. The quality and freshness of the food can vary greatly by location as well.</p>
<p>Quizno&#8217;s offers a variety of subs, sandwiches, soups, and wraps. I&#8217;ve never had a sub that was particularly bad, but a really good Quizno&#8217;s sub is hard to find. If I had to choose between Quizno&#8217;s or Subway, I&#8217;d go with Quizno&#8217;s, unless I know a particular location is bad. It really is a gamble going to Quizno&#8217;s though, because, unless you&#8217;ve been to that location before, you don&#8217;t know if you will have a good or bad experience. Quizno&#8217;s, as a company, really needs to wrangle in their franchises, have all locations honor coupons, and provide more uniform service and food quality.</p>
